About SOLAR AFRICA - KENYA

Overview

SOLAR AFRICA - KENYA is the 11th Solar Africa trade exhibition organized by Expogroup. The official Solar Kenya 2026 page states the event will run from 29–31 July 2026 at the Carnivore Exhibition Grounds in Nairobi, Kenya.

Expogroup’s FAQ and registration pages indicate the show is open to industry professionals, visitor entry is free, and online pre-registration is encouraged. The event appears scheduled, with no cancellation or postponement notice found on the official pages reviewed.

What to Expect

Attendees can expect a focused solar and renewable energy trade exhibition centered on products, technologies, and business development for the East African market. The official pages show that the event is built for industry professionals, with free visitor access, daily show hours from 10:00 a.m. to 06:00 p.m., and online visitor pre-registration encouraged. Who Should Attend

Solar installers, EPC contractors, project developers, distributors, wholesalers, importers, manufacturers, electrical engineers, consultants, utilities, energy policymakers, commercial and industrial energy users, real estate and infrastructure decision-makers, and procurement teams evaluating solar and storage solutions.
